Hamilton Watch Co. {How a Watch Works} on CD

Two vintage films from the late 1940’s produced by the Hamilton Watch Company explaining how manual wind watches are designed, assembled and how they work.
Film #1 - How A Watch Works - A simple demonstration of the basic design and operation of a watch, including stop-motion animation showing a watch being assembled from many parts. A huge 7.5 foot model allows you to see the intricate inner workings of a watch. You will come away amazed at the precision that goes into watch making. Made in 1949 with a run time of 18:40
Film #2 - What Makes A Fine Watch Fine - History and practice of precision watchmaking at the Hamilton factory in Lancaster, Pennsylvania. Includes a retirement presentation. Made in 1947 with a run time of 19:54

Both movies presented on a Gift Quality CD.
